The Magic of Cabaret Day 5This evening we are pleased to present this lovely piece by Japanese automata maker Kazu Harada called ‘Decoy’.

The piece is beautifully carved, a sculpture which would grace any room.
Turn the handle for a surprise, the duck lays an egg, which then disappears.

Kazu spent a year studying in the UK in 2006 at University College Falmouth, and worked closely with Matt Smith and Fourteen Ball Toy Company where he developed his own style.

His piece ‘Banana Boat’ is currently on display at the CMT exhibition in DASA.
